Python und CAD
Python Software Foundation

Python und CAD

Automatisierung von FreeCAD, QCAD und SVG-Workflows mit Python praxisnah umsetzen

Die wichtigsten Themen

Python-CAD-Automatisierung

FreeCAD und Sketcher per Skript

SVG-Workflows mit Inkscape

QCAD-Skripte generieren

Praxisbeispiele aus dem CAD-Alltag

Überblick Python ist im CAD-Umfeld ein wirkungsvolles Werkzeug, wenn wiederkehrende Konstruktionsaufgaben automatisiert, Geometrien parametrisch erzeugt oder Zeichnungsdaten für weitere Prozesse vorbereitet werden sollen. In...

Python ist im CAD-Umfeld ein wirkungsvolles Werkzeug, wenn wiederkehrende Konstruktionsaufgaben automatisiert, Geometrien parametrisch erzeugt oder Zeichnungsdaten für weitere Prozesse vorbereitet werden sollen. In dieser Python-CAD-Schulung lernst du, wie CAD-Anwendungen wie FreeCAD, QCAD und weitere Werkzeuge mit Python angesteuert und erweitert werden. Der Schwerpunkt liegt auf praxisnahen Beispielen: Linien, Skizzen, 2D-Geometrien und SVG-Daten werden nicht manuell erzeugt, sondern per Skript systematisch aufgebaut.

Das Training richtet sich an Personen, die bereits mit CAD arbeiten und Python gezielt für Konstruktion, Automatisierung und wiederholbare Zeichenprozesse einsetzen möchten. Begriffe wie cad python, python cad software oder python for cad stehen dabei nicht abstrakt im Raum, sondern werden anhand nachvollziehbarer Workflows umgesetzt. Wer seine Python-Grundlagen auffrischen möchte, findet mit dem Python 3 Grundkurs intensiv eine passende Vorbereitung. Für CAD-Grundlagen und angrenzende Konstruktions-Themen bieten sich außerdem die CAD- und Grafik-Schulungen, der FreeCAD Kurs für Umsteiger oder die BricsCAD 2D Schulung Grundkurs an.

Die Themen Einsatzmöglichkeiten von Python zur Automatisierung wiederkehrender CAD-Aufgaben · Grundprinzipien skriptbasierter Zeichnungserzeugung im CAD-Bereich...

Python im CAD-Workflow

  • Einsatzmöglichkeiten von Python zur Automatisierung wiederkehrender CAD-Aufgaben
  • Grundprinzipien skriptbasierter Zeichnungserzeugung im CAD-Bereich
  • Strukturierung von CAD-Skripten für nachvollziehbare und wiederverwendbare Abläufe
  • Typische Anwendungsfälle für cad in python und python for cad

FreeCAD und Sketcher automatisieren

  • Arbeiten mit FreeCAD als Python-steuerbarer CAD-Anwendung
  • Erzeugen vieler Linien mit Python als praxisnahes Hello-World-Beispiel
  • Grundlagen der Arbeit mit dem Sketcher in skriptbasierten CAD-Szenarien
  • Aufbau einfacher 2D-Geometrien über Python-Skripte

SVG und 2D-Geometrien mit Inkscape

  • Erzeugen vieler Linien im Web-Format SVG
  • Verständnis von SVG als 2D-Austauschformat für grafische und CAD-nahe Anwendungen
  • Automatisierte Ausgabe von Zeichnungsstrukturen für weitere Verarbeitungsschritte
  • Verbindung von Python-Logik und vektorbasierten Zeichenformaten

QCAD und generierte Skripte

  • Automatisiertes Zeichnen vieler Linien in QCAD
  • Generieren von JavaScript-Code mit Python für QCAD-Workflows
  • Zusammenspiel von Python, JavaScript und CAD-Anwendungen
  • Praktische Beispiele zur Automatisierung wiederholbarer Zeichenoperationen

Praxisbeispiele für Python und CAD

  • Umsetzung weiterer Beispiele für die Kombination von CAD und Python
  • Analyse wiederkehrender Konstruktionsaufgaben mit Automatisierungspotenzial
  • Übertragung manueller CAD-Schritte in nachvollziehbare Skriptlogik
  • Einordnung von Python-CAD-Workflows in bestehende Konstruktionsprozesse
Wer hier richtig ist
  • Konstrukteurinnen und Konstrukteure, die wiederkehrende CAD-Zeichenaufgaben mit Python automatisieren möchten
  • CAD-Anwenderinnen und CAD-Anwender aus Planung, Entwicklung und technischer Zeichnung mit Interesse an Skript-Workflows
  • Software-Entwicklerinnen und Software-Entwickler, die CAD-Anwendungen wie FreeCAD oder QCAD in automatisierte Prozesse einbinden
  • Technische Fachkräfte, die Python-CAD-Software praxisnah für 2D-Geometrien, SVG-Ausgaben und parametrische Abläufe nutzen möchten
Das lernst du
  • Sicherer Einstieg in die Automatisierung von CAD-Anwendungen mit Python
  • Eigene Skripte zur Erzeugung von Linien, Skizzen und 2D-Geometrien erstellen
  • FreeCAD, Sketcher, Inkscape und QCAD in nachvollziehbare Automatisierungsabläufe einordnen
  • SVG-Daten und generierte Skripte für CAD-nahe Workflows nutzen
  • Wiederkehrende Zeichenaufgaben analysieren und in Python-basierte Lösungen überführen
So arbeiten wir
  • Praxisnahe Live-Demos zur Automatisierung von FreeCAD, Inkscape und QCAD
  • Hands-on-Übungen mit Python-Skripten für CAD-nahe Aufgabenstellungen
  • Schrittweise Entwicklung nachvollziehbarer Beispiele von der einfachen Linie bis zum wiederverwendbaren Workflow
  • Besprechung typischer Stolperstellen bei der Verbindung von Python, CAD-Anwendungen und Austauschformaten
  • Praxisbeispiele aus Konstruktion, technischer Zeichnung und Skript-Automatisierung
Empfohlene Vorkenntnisse
  • Python-Kenntnisse auf dem Niveau eines Grundkurses, zum Beispiel aus dem Python 3 Grundkurs intensiv
  • Gute CAD-Kenntnisse und sicherer Umgang mit grundlegenden Zeichen- und Konstruktionsfunktionen
  • Grundverständnis für 2D-Geometrien, Linien, Skizzen und technische Zeichnungen
  • Interesse an Automatisierung, Skripting und reproduzierbaren CAD-Workflows
Dein Fahrplan

Zu Beginn werden die Einsatzmöglichkeiten von Python im CAD-Umfeld eingeordnet. Anschließend entstehen erste Skripte zur automatisierten Erzeugung einfacher Geometrien. FreeCAD und Sketcher dienen als praktische Umgebung, um viele Linien und grundlegende 2D-Strukturen per Python zu erzeugen.

  • Einordnung typischer Automatisierungsaufgaben im CAD-Bereich
  • Python als Werkzeug für reproduzierbare Zeichenprozesse
  • FreeCAD und Sketcher in skriptbasierten Workflows
  • Erzeugen vieler Linien als erstes Praxisbeispiel
  • Strukturierung einfacher CAD-Skripte
Organisatorisches

Lernformate

Unsere Seminare bieten dir maximale Flexibilität: Du kannst zwischen Live-Online und Vor Ort in unseren modernen Schulungszentren im D-A-CH Raum wählen. Beide Formate garantieren dir die gleiche hohe Qualität und interaktive Lernerfahrung.

Schulungsarten

Wir bieten dir verschiedene Schulungsarten: Offene Seminare, Firmenseminare für Teams und Inhouse-Schulungen direkt bei dir vor Ort. So findest du genau das Format, das zu deinen Bedürfnissen passt.

Uhrzeiten

09:00-16:00 Uhr

Aktuelle Software

In unseren offenen Kursen arbeiten wir mit der aktuellsten Software-Version. So lernst du direkt mit den Tools und Features, die du auch in deinem Arbeitsalltag verwendest - praxisnah und zukunftsorientiert. Bei Inhouse- und Firmenschulungen bestimmt ihr die Version.

Deine Vorteile

Zufriedenheitsgarantie

Wir sind von unserer Qualität überzeugt. Sollte ein Training einmal nicht deinen Erwartungen entsprechen, bieten wir dir an, den Kurs kostenlos zu wiederholen oder ein anderes Training zu besuchen. Ohne Risiko, ohne Diskussion.

Inklusivleistungen

Deine Teilnahme beinhaltet: Schulungsmaterial, Zertifikat, Verpflegung (bei Präsenzveranstaltungen) und persönliche Betreuung durch unsere Trainer und unser Orga-Team. Alles aus einer Hand - keine versteckten Kosten.

Lernen von Experten

Unsere Trainer sind zertifizierte und erfahrene Profis mit jahrelanger Berufserfahrung. Sie vermitteln dir in den Kursen nicht nur theoretisches Wissen, sondern teilen ihre Erfahrungen aus realen Projekten und helfen dir, das Gelernte direkt in deiner täglichen Arbeit anzuwenden. Das ist kein Werbeversprechen, sondern unser Anspruch. Am besten siehst du das in unseren Bewertungen, z.B. auch bei Google.

Keine Vorkasse

Du zahlst erst nach dem Seminar. Keine Vorkasse, keine Vorauszahlung - so kannst du sicher sein, dass du nur für das bezahlst, was du auch wirklich erhalten hast. Die Rechnung erhältst du erst nach Kursbeginn.

Max. 8 Teilnehmende

Wir setzen auf kleine Gruppen, damit du die Aufmerksamkeit bekommst, die du verdienst. So haben wir mehr Zeit für deine individuellen Fragen und können gezielt auf deine Bedürfnisse eingehen.

Termine & Buchung

Vor Ort

Standardpreis: 1.090,00 € netto (1.297,10 € brutto)
27. - 28.08.2026
22. - 23.10.2026
07. - 08.01.2027
25. - 26.02.2027
29. - 30.04.2027

Online

Standardpreis: 1.090,00 € netto (1.297,10 € brutto)
27. - 28.08.2026
22. - 23.10.2026
07. - 08.01.2027
25. - 26.02.2027
29. - 30.04.2027

Nicht der passende Termin dabei?

Wir finden eine Lösung: anderer Termin, mehrere Teilnehmer, Inhouse-Schulung oder individuelle Beratung.

Anfrage stellen
Inhouse & Firmenseminare

Lieber gleich das ganze Team schulen?

Diese Schulung gibt es auch exklusiv für dein Unternehmen, bei euch vor Ort, an unseren Standorten oder Live-Online. Inhalte und Termine nach Maß.

Beliebteste Wahl

Inhouse-Schulung

Wir kommen zu euch: diese Schulung maßgeschneidert in euren Räumen, für Unternehmen und Behörden.

  • Inhalte exakt auf euch zugeschnitten
  • Termine nach euren Bedürfnissen
  • Günstiger ab mehreren Teilnehmern
  • Vertraute Umgebung, kein Reiseaufwand
Inhouse-Schulung anfragen

Firmen-Seminar

Exklusiv für dein Team an einem unserer Standorte oder Live-Online, individuell angepasst.

  • Geschlossene Gruppe aus eurem Haus
  • Individuelle Terminplanung
  • An unseren Standorten oder Live-Online
  • Angepasste Inhalte
Firmen-Seminar anfragen

Fragen und Antworten zu Python und CAD

Für wen eignet sich die Python-und-CAD-Schulung?

Die Schulung eignet sich für dich, wenn du CAD-Anwendungen bereits nutzt und wiederkehrende Zeichen- oder Konstruktionsaufgaben automatisieren möchtest. Besonders relevant ist das Training für Konstruktion, technische Zeichnung, Entwicklung und Software-nahe CAD-Prozesse.

Welche Python-Kenntnisse werden vorausgesetzt?

Du solltest Python-Grundlagen sicher anwenden, insbesondere Variablen, Schleifen, Funktionen und einfache Skriptstrukturen. Wenn diese Basis noch fehlt, ist der Python 3 Grundkurs intensiv eine sinnvolle Vorbereitung.

Welche CAD-Programme werden im Training behandelt?

Im Seminar werden unter anderem FreeCAD mit Sketcher, Inkscape für SVG-Workflows und QCAD behandelt. Der Schwerpunkt liegt nicht auf einer vollständigen Bedienerschulung einzelner Programme, sondern auf der Automatisierung von CAD-nahen Aufgaben mit Python.

Was bedeutet cad in python praktisch?

Cad in python bedeutet in diesem Training, dass Zeichnungs- und Geometrieaufgaben nicht manuell geklickt, sondern per Python-Skript erzeugt oder vorbereitet werden. Beispiele sind viele Linien, 2D-Strukturen, SVG-Ausgaben oder generierte Skripte für QCAD.

Ist das Seminar auch für CAD-Anwender ohne Programmiererfahrung geeignet?

Das Seminar setzt Python-Kenntnisse voraus. Reine CAD-Anwenderinnen und CAD-Anwender ohne Programmiererfahrung sollten zuerst Python-Grundlagen aufbauen und anschließend in die CAD-Automatisierung einsteigen.

Geht es um 2D-CAD, 3D-CAD oder beides?

Der Schwerpunkt liegt auf CAD-nahen 2D-Beispielen, Linien, Skizzen und SVG-Daten. FreeCAD wird mit dem Sketcher betrachtet, QCAD wird für automatisiertes Zeichnen genutzt. Weitere Praxisbeispiele zeigen, wie sich Python und CAD sinnvoll kombinieren lassen.

Welche weiterführenden CAD-Schulungen passen dazu?

Je nach eingesetzter Software können ergänzend der FreeCAD Kurs für Umsteiger, die BricsCAD 2D Schulung Grundkurs oder weitere CAD- und Grafik-Schulungen sinnvoll sein.

Weitere häufig gestellte Fragen und Antworten findest du in den FAQs .

Unser Qualitätsversprechen: Wissen, das in der Praxis funktioniert

Aus der Praxis für die Praxis

Schluss mit theoretischem Ballast. Wir trainieren dich für reale IT-Herausforderungen, nicht für Multiple-Choice-Tests. Unsere Trainer vermitteln dir genau das Wissen, das am nächsten Montagmorgen im Job wirklich funktioniert.

Individuell statt "Schema F"

Deine Fragen passen nicht ins Standard-Skript? Bei uns schon. Wir verzichten auf starre Lehrpläne und geben deinen konkreten Projekt-Fragen Raum. Unsere Trainer passen die Inhalte flexibel an das an, was dich und dein Team aktuell weiterbringt.

Maximale Freiheit: Remote oder vor Ort

Lerne so, wie es in deinen Alltag passt - ohne Reise-Stress und Zeitverlust. Egal ob remote, hybrid oder präsent vor Ort: Wir garantieren dir ein nahtloses und effektives Lernerlebnis, egal von wo du dich zuschaltest.

Mit Zufriedenheitsgarantie

Wir sind von unserer Qualität überzeugt - und wollen, dass du es auch bist. Sollte ein Training einmal nicht deinen Erwartungen entsprechen, bieten wir dir an, den Kurs kostenlos zu wiederholen oder ein anderes Training zu besuchen. Ohne Risiko, ohne Diskussion.

Über 20.000 Unternehmen und Behörden vertrauen auf uns

Alle Referenzen
Siemens Logo
Telekom Logo
Rheinmetall Logo
Infineon Logo
MAN Logo
Fraunhofer Logo
ADAC Logo
Munich Re Logo
Deutsche Bahn Logo
ab 1.090 €
zzgl. 19% MwSt.